'Quintus Oakes: A Detective Story' Summary
Quintus Oakes, a brilliant detective, is called to investigate a series of disturbing events at a secluded manor house. Amidst rumors of supernatural occurrences, Oakes uncovers a web of hidden secrets and dark motives lurking within the household. As he pieces together the clues, he realizes that the truth behind the assaults and murder is far more sinister than it seems. With his sharp intellect and unwavering determination, Oakes navigates the treacherous path, unmasking the killer and bringing justice to the tormented manor.Book Details
